On Wednesday, South Korea’s Kospi experienced its most significant single-day drop, continuing a pronounced sell-off from the prior session, as a wider downturn in Asian markets unfolded, driven by deteriorating investor sentiment due to the intensifying conflict in the Middle East. On Wednesday, trading for the Kospi index was temporarily suspended by the Korea Exchange. Read More
